**Core Concept**
The Human Leukocyte Antigen (HLA) system is a part of the immune system and is crucial for the body's defense against pathogens. **HLA class I** molecules are involved in presenting endogenously synthesized peptides to CD8+ T cells. They are expressed on the surface of almost all nucleated cells.
**Why the Correct Answer is Right**
HLA-I molecules are expressed on the surface of nearly all nucleated cells, as they present peptides from inside the cell to the immune system, helping to identify and kill infected cells or tumor cells. This widespread expression is critical for the immune system's ability to survey the body for cells that have been compromised by viruses or cancer. The **major histocompatibility complex (MHC) class I** molecules are the HLA-I antigens in humans.
